Factors to Consider When Choosing Best Folding Squat Racks

Wall Space and Footprint

Measure your available wall width and ceiling height before you commit. Most folding racks extend 20 to 25 inches from the wall when in use, so ensure you have enough floor clearance for your barbell and bench. Check your wall studs to confirm they align with the standard 16-inch or 24-inch spacing. If your studs do not match the rack's mounting holes, you will need a stringer board to create a secure foundation.

Steel Gauge and Weight Capacity

Look for racks built with 11-gauge steel to ensure the frame remains rigid under heavy loads. Thinner steel may flex during squats, which creates an unsettling experience when you are under a heavy barbell. A high weight capacity is vital for long-term safety. Most professional-grade folding racks handle at least 1,000 pounds, providing enough overhead to keep your training focused on the lift rather than the equipment limits.

Mounting Style and Stringers

Decide between a wall-mounted stringer or a direct-to-stud installation. A stringer board distributes the weight across multiple studs, acting like a bridge that provides extra stability for your rack. If you prefer a cleaner aesthetic, direct mounting works well for lighter training sessions. However, a stringer is almost always the smarter choice to prevent the rack from pulling away from the wall over time.

Upright Hole Spacing

Pay attention to the hole spacing on the uprights, specifically the Westside hole spacing in the bench press zone. This allows for smaller, more precise adjustments to your safety pin heights. Standard hole spacing is fine for general squats, but micro-adjustments protect your shoulders. If you train alone, these tighter gaps are essential for setting safety pins at the perfect height.

Pin and Hinge Reliability

The hinge mechanism is the heartbeat of your folding rack. You want quick-release pins that slide into place with a satisfying click, allowing you to fold or unfold the unit in under a minute. Check that the hinge joints move smoothly without excessive play. If the pins are flimsy or the bolts loosen, the rack will rattle like a loose window pane during your set.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is a folding rack as stable as a permanent power rack?

A high-quality folding rack is just as stable as a permanent unit if installed correctly. The secret lies in the mounting hardware and the quality of your wall studs. Once the pull-up bar is locked into place, the entire frame becomes a rigid structure. You will not notice a difference in performance during your heaviest squats.

Do I need a professional to install a folding rack?

You can install these racks yourself if you own a power drill and a socket set. You must use a level to ensure the uprights are perfectly vertical before driving the lag bolts. If you are not comfortable working with structural timber or wall anchors, hire a local contractor. An improperly mounted rack is a significant safety hazard.

Can I do pull-ups on a folding rack?

Yes, the pull-up bar is usually the final piece that locks the rack into its open position. This provides the necessary tension to keep the uprights steady. Make sure the rack is rated for your body weight plus any added resistance. Most models handle aggressive kipping or weighted pull-ups without issue.

Will the rack damage my floor?

Most folding racks include rubber feet on the base of the uprights to protect your floor. These prevent the metal from scratching wood or concrete surfaces during the folding process. If your rack does not have pads, place a gym mat or a piece of rubber flooring underneath. This also helps reduce noise and vibration during your workout.

What accessories are compatible with these racks?

Most manufacturers use standard tubing sizes, such as 2×2 or 3×3 inches. This makes them compatible with a wide range of J-cups, spotter arms, and landmine attachments. Always double-check the tube dimensions before buying third-party add-ons. If the hole diameter does not match your rack, the attachments will not fit securely.
